In December 2014 the United Nations declared 21st June as ‘International Day of Yoga’ after 177 nations across all continents of the world co-sponsored a resolution seeking the same.

When the resolution was adopted, Prime Minister Narendra Modi expressed immense joy on this and said that Yoga has the power to bring the entire humankind together. It may be recalled that the Prime Minister had mooted such an idea during his speech at the United Nations General Assembly in September 2014.
